Output 594de9864f7c4d35567a17a66ef759778d30ed53195ce46da3aba4216373973a:1

value
31000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 adaf4570cfd789a7afde08aebf0eaa3ac87ca162 OP_EQUAL
address
A8GdXdsYRLqvA5oj915f3xPNmzWx3N7WPm
transaction
594de9864f7c4d35567a17a66ef759778d30ed53195ce46da3aba4216373973a